Movie Rentals nearby The Chambers Chelsea Harbour, London, Chelsea Harbour SW10 0XF, UK

Pamina

Approximately 0.25 km away
Address: 90 Lots Rd, London SW10 0QD, United Kingdom

Prime Time Video

Approximately 1.94 km away
Address: 115 Gloucester Road, London SW7 4ST, United Kingdom

Getcandy Entertainment Ltd

Approximately 1.96 km away
Address: 75 Warwick Road, Greater London SW5 9HB, United Kingdom